Role overview
An opportunity has opened for a qualified registered nurse to join the busy and growing Glenfield Outpatients team at University Hospitals of Leicester NHS Trust. The department supports a broad mix of specialties, including Respiratory, Cardiology, Vascular, Oncology, Breast Care, Orthopaedics and NCSEM at Loughborough University.
The outpatients service offers a welcoming, progressive environment in pleasant surroundings, with a strong focus on improving patient care while working closely with the multidisciplinary teams that rely on the service.

Clinical duties
The post holder will assess, plan, implement and evaluate evidence-based nursing care for a group of patients. You will also play an active part in maintaining high standards of nursing quality and act as a positive clinical and professional example for students and learners on placement in the clinical area.
Working arrangements and physical demands
This position may require frequent walking and long periods of standing. The successful candidate must be able to use manual handling equipment such as hoists, trolleys and wheelchairs.
You may also be asked to work at other Trust locations in addition to your main base. Flexibility is required across four sites: Leicester Royal Infirmary, Glenfield Hospital, Loughborough NCSEM and Leicester General Hospital. If your starting site is one of these, excess travel reimbursement will not apply for a permanent or temporary change of base.
Trust strategy and values
The Trust’s 2023–2030 strategy is built around four main goals: delivering high-quality care for all, being a great place to work, creating partnerships that make a difference, and achieving excellence in research and education. The organisation also aims to embed health equality in all its work by reducing avoidable healthcare differences through partnership with communities.
The values guiding this work are compassion, pride, inclusivity and teamwork.
